Valve is persuading the HDMI Forum to allow open source support for HDMI 2.1 on Linux (SteamOS) without restrictions 💫

This video standard brawl isn't a do-or-die problem for the Steam Machine - most won’t even notice.

The HDMI Forum holds Linux gaming back artificially tho. Society could just drop HDMI, adopting free'er DisplayPort where common sense is missing 😉

If Valve succeeds towards '26 - it'll be a huge victory for all.
